    Electrical Maintenance Engineer

    Dorset | J4 Resourcing

    Job Details
    Category: Trades & Services
    Posted Today
    Electrical Maintenance Engineer The role The carry out of electrical maintenance, repair and installation works in accordance with the operational and maintenance plan in order to Improve operational reliability and availability of the plant and machinery at the lowest effective maintenance costs for all equipment, installations and buildings on site. Ensuring all works carried out is done so with Health, Safety, Environmental and Product Quality standards being the priority at all times. Main duties To provide electrical repair and maintenance skills including fault identification and analysis to facilitate repairs, improvements, inspections, adjustments and refurbishments to agreed standards. Installation and commissioning of power and control cabling for, electrical drive and process equipment upgrades and new installation. Repair, maintenance, calibration and testing of process instrumentation, sensors transmitters and transducers of, e.g. load cells for weigh systems, level control devices, PID controllers, proximity sensors, temperature transmitters, etc. Working with, installing and maintaining safety critical control systems and associated interlocks, e-stop circuits, pull wire systems, etc. Work alone to find and present faults and concerns in electrical systems without receiving explicit direction Assess the parts needed for jobs and feedback the information to enable required parts to be ordered. Test electrical systems and continuity of circuits in electrical wiring, equipment, and fixtures, using testing devices such as ohmmeters, voltmeters, etc. to ensure, integrity, compatibility and safety of system. Carry out of control and variable speed drive systems, maintenance, inspection set up and repair Installation, maintenance and repair of general facilities electrical equipment including, lighting, emergency light inspection, testing and repair, PAT testing, portable electrical equipment Ensure occupational health and safety, to comply with the Health & Safety at Work Act 1974 and to observe the requirements of the Company Safety Policy and other relevant legislation Where applicable understand programming/fault rectification on PLC systems associated with the control of production systems, e.g. Allen Bradley SLC/PLC5/Control Logix, Siemens S5/S7, etc. Work LV switchgear, to carry out cable and transformer system inspection and test regimes Ensuring work areas are kept clear at all times and that unused and waste material are returned to stores or properly disposed of at all times. Ensure all work is completed in a safe and timely manner and where required details of work carried out is reported to relevant Supervisor and recorded on Maintenance managements systems. Ensure that tools required for tasks are kept in good condition and that all defects are reported immediately. Be a member of the electrical maintenance callout rota. Performing other duties as requested by the supervisor and management team. About you Completed a recognised Electrical Engineering apprenticeship, City & Guilds Electrical qualification or relevant NVQ Level 3. IEE 17th Edition Wiring Regulations Desirable Testing and inspection 2391/2 or equivalent. (236 Part 1/ 2) Experience Minimum of 4+ years previous Electrical maintenance experience gained within heavy industry, quarrying, continuous process industry, etc. 4+ years experience of Industrial safety standards and systems of work, including equipment isolation, testing for dead and permitting systems. 4+ years proven experience of fault finding and problem solving on a range of Heavy Industrial electrical / plc control and power supply circuits. Knowledge Knowledge of IEE Code of Practice for In-Service Inspection and Testing of Electrical Equipment Principles of basic bench fitting and engineering standards. Basic operation of main stream computer systems, windows, apple, android, etc. Desirable Working knowledge of IEE regulations, City & Guilds 2360 and 2382 qualifications, and inspection and testing certificate (2391) LV Electrical distribution and control circuit design and configuration
